import { McpServer } from "@modelcontextprotocol/sdk/server/mcp.js";
import { StdioServerTransport } from "@modelcontextprotocol/sdk/server/stdio.js";
import { SSEServerTransport } from "@modelcontextprotocol/sdk/server/sse.js";
import express, { Request, Response } from "express";
import http from 'http';
// Basic server info
const serverInfo = {
name: "mcp-msoffice-interop-word",
version: "1.0.0",
};
// Create the MCP server instance
const mcpServer = new McpServer(serverInfo, {
instructions: "MCP Server for interacting with Microsoft Word.",
});
// --- Register Resources and Tools ---
import { registerDocumentTools } from "./tools/document-tools.js";
import { registerTextTools } from "./tools/text-tools.js";
import { registerParagraphTools } from "./tools/paragraph-tools.js";
import { registerTableTools } from "./tools/table-tools.js";
import { registerImageTools } from "./tools/image-tools.js";
import { registerHeaderFooterTools } from "./tools/header-footer-tools.js";
import { registerPageSetupTools } from "./tools/page-setup-tools.js";
import { registerCursorSelectionTools } from "./tools/cursor-selection-tools.js";
// Import other tool/resource registration functions here
registerDocumentTools(mcpServer);
registerTextTools(mcpServer);
registerParagraphTools(mcpServer);
registerTableTools(mcpServer);
registerImageTools(mcpServer);
registerHeaderFooterTools(mcpServer);
registerPageSetupTools(mcpServer);
registerCursorSelectionTools(mcpServer);
// Call other registration functions here
// mcpServer.resource(...)
// --- Transport Setup ---
async function startServer() {
const transportMode = process.env.MCP_TRANSPORT || 'stdio'; // Default to stdio
if (transportMode === 'stdio') {
console.log("Starting MCP server with stdio transport...");
const transport = new StdioServerTransport();
await mcpServer.connect(transport);
console.log("MCP server connected via stdio.");
} else if (transportMode === 'sse') {
const port = process.env.PORT || 3001;
const app = express();
const httpServer = http.createServer(app);
// Store transports by session ID for multiple connections
const transports: { [sessionId: string]: SSEServerTransport } = {};
app.get("/sse", async (_req: Request, res: Response) => {
console.log("SSE connection requested");
const transport = new SSEServerTransport('/messages', res);
transports[transport.sessionId] = transport;
console.log(`SSE transport created with session ID: ${transport.sessionId}`);
res.on("close", () => {
console.log(`SSE connection closed for session ID: ${transport.sessionId}`);
delete transports[transport.sessionId];
// Optionally, notify the server instance if needed
// mcpServer.disconnectClient(transport.sessionId);
});
try {
await mcpServer.connect(transport);
console.log(`MCP server connected via SSE for session ID: ${transport.sessionId}`);
} catch (error) {
console.error(`Error connecting MCP server via SSE for session ID: ${transport.sessionId}`, error);
// Ensure response is ended if connection fails
if (!res.writableEnded) {
res.status(500).end('Failed to connect MCP server');
}
}
});
// Middleware to parse JSON bodies for POST requests
app.use('/messages', express.json({ limit: '4mb' })); // Adjust limit as needed
app.post("/messages", async (req: Request, res: Response) => {
const sessionId = req.query.sessionId as string;
console.log(`Received POST message for session ID: ${sessionId}`);
const transport = transports[sessionId];
if (transport) {
try {
// Pass the already parsed body if using express.json()
await transport.handlePostMessage(req, res, req.body);
console.log(`Handled POST message for session ID: ${sessionId}`);
} catch (error) {
console.error(`Error handling POST message for session ID: ${sessionId}`, error);
if (!res.headersSent) {
res.status(400).send('Error processing message');
}
}
} else {
console.warn(`No active SSE transport found for session ID: ${sessionId}`);
res.status(400).send('No transport found for sessionId');
}
});
httpServer.listen(port, () => {
console.log(`MCP server listening with SSE transport on port ${port}`);
console.log(`SSE endpoint: /sse`);
console.log(`Message endpoint: /messages`);
});
} else {
console.error(`Unsupported MCP_TRANSPORT: ${transportMode}. Use 'stdio' or 'sse'.`);
process.exit(1);
}
}
startServer().catch(error => {
console.error("Failed to start MCP server:", error);
process.exit(1);
});
